## 3.2.0 — Changed defaults

Aligned defaults between the Skerrel JS and Kotlin SDKs. Retry backoff, timeout, and pagination size now match across both. Kotlin previously defaulted to eager token refresh; now lazy, same as JS. Breaking for anyone relying on old Kotlin behavior. The new shared defaults are as follows.

service settings:
[casax]
port = 6379
team = rusir
host = casax.zemvarhq.corp
region = outer-4
access_code = ac_9808ce
timeout_ms = 1500

### Step 4: Enable log sampling for Chirpd

Chirpd emits roughly 40k lines per minute at peak, so always enable sampling before raising verbosity. Set the sample rate to 1:50 in the Larkwell config overlay, then restart only the ingest pods. Verify sampling took effect by checking the banner line, which prints the active trace token below.

session token of tajog-fahaf = htk21_4ae55819f45410afcb307

# Client setup for Twigreaper, the stale-branch cleanup bot.
# The bot scans repos nightly and deletes branches with no
# commits in 90 days, skipping anything labeled 'keep'.
# If cleanup runs stall, restart the worker rather than the
# scheduler. The client authenticates to the internal repo
# service with the key below.

app token of yajeg-kawef = kto11_7En3XSX8xQw

## Onboarding — TrakLoop Webhook

TrakLoop receives parcel status events from carrier partners and writes them to the `events_inbound` table. Review checklist: verify signature validation in `verify.go`, confirm idempotency keys are enforced, and reject payloads over 64KB. Retries use exponential backoff, capped at six attempts. Dead-lettered events land in `events_failed` for manual replay. Schema changes require a migration plus a reviewer sign-off. To inspect the staging database during review, use the connection string below.

primary connection of yagep-kahip = redis://giliel_svc:zYiKsLL2PLpfPL@db-348f.xolmarsys.corp:5432/fenwyn